/* CSS Document */

*, body, html, h1, h2, h3, h4, h5, table, tr, td, ul, li{	margin:0;	padding:0;}

body {font-family:"News Gothic Std","Lucida Sans Unicode", "Lucida Grande","Helvetica", "Arial", sans-serif; background-color:#000000; color:#808080;font-size:15px;}
table td {vertical-align:top;}
h1 { font-size:21px; font-weight:normal;margin:0px 20px; padding:0px 0px 5px 5px;border-bottom:1px solid #e7e7e7; }

h2 { font-size:23px; font-weight:normal;padding-bottom:15px;}
h3 { font-size:19px; font-weight:normal;color:#000;padding-bottom:15px;}
h4 { font-size:15px; font-weight:normal;padding-bottom:5px;}
h5 { font-size:11px; font-weight:normal;padding-bottom:15px;}

h1 .sub {float:right;padding-right:20px;}
em {font-style:normal;}
a {text-decoration:none;color:#888888;}
hove {text-decoration:underline;}
p {font-wieght:normal;font-size:14px;}
.quoted p  {padding-bottom:0px;font-style:italic;}
/*defines highlight colors for each individual page category*/
#what-we-do h1, #what-we-do em, #what-we-do .ldquo , #what-we-do .rdquo, #what-we-do .selected, #what-we-do a:hover , #what-we-do h4,#what-we-do .questions li a{color:#000;}
#products   h1, #products em, #products .ldquo , #products .rdquo, #products .selected, #products a:hover, #products h4,#products questions li a {color:#fd8b04;}
#clients    h1, #clients em, #clients .ldquo , #clients .rdquo, #clients .selected, #clients a:hover, #clients h4,#clients .questions li a   {color:#50ba0a;}
#contact    h1, #contact em, #contact .ldquo , #contact .rdquo, #contact .selected, #contact a:hover, #contact h4,#contact .questions li a   {color:#c70101;}
#products.business    h1, #products.business em, #products.business .ldquo , #products.business .rdquo, #products.business .selected, #products.business a:hover , #products.business h4,#products.business .questions li a {color:#69006e;}
#products.people    h1, #products.people em, #products.people .ldquo , #products.people .rdquo, #products.people .selected, #products.people a:hover , #products.people h4,#products.people .questions li a {color:#FF9900;}

#logo {width:284px;height:108px;text-align:left;}
#logo a {width:284px;height:108px;}
#page { background-image: url(/wp-content/themes/digitalagua/images/bg/middle.png); background-repeat: repeat-y;background-position: center top;background-color:#000;}

#pageContent {	width:956px;	margin:0 auto;	background-image: url(/wp-content/themes/digitalagua/images/bg/top.png);	background-repeat: no-repeat;	background-position: center top;}

#home h2 ,#home h1 {color:#fff; font-size:20px; font-weight:normal;margin-bottom:10px;}
#home-temp h2 ,#home-temp h1 {color:#fff; font-size:20px; font-weight:normal;margin-bottom:10px;}
#home h2 {padding:10px 0px 0px 12px;}
#home h1 {padding:10px 0px 0px 12px;border:none;}
#home-temp h1 {padding:10px 0px 0px 12px;border:none;}
#home #header {height:120px;}
#home-temp #header {height:120px;}

#pageContent  #header { text-align:left;}
#header { height:125px;width:954px;}
#header ul { float:right;margin:80px 05px 0px 0px ;width:420px;height:20px;list-style: none;font-size:16px;}
#header ul li { float:left;width:100px;height:20px;text-align:center; }
#header ul li a {z-index: 100;float:left;display:block;color:#fff;text-align:center; padding-top:0px; width:100px; height:20px;text-decoration:none; background-repeat: no-repeat; background-position: center top;}
/*
#header ul li.about a { background-image: url(/img/icons/icon-green.png);} 
#header ul li.contact a { background-image: url(/img/icons/icon-red.png);}
#header ul li.clients a { background-image: url(/img/icons/icon-blue.png);}
#header ul li.products a { background-image: url(/img/icons/icon-orange.png);}
*/
#header ul li.selected {font-weight:bold;}
#body { margin:0px 24px;}

#footer { clear:both;width:956px;margin:0px auto 40px auto;color:#fff; background-color:#000;	padding-top:35px;background-image: url(/wp-content/themes/digitalagua/images/bg/bottom.png);background-repeat: no-repeat;	background-position: center top;}

#footer ul { list-style:none;margin-left:25px;}
#footer ul li { float:left;}
#footer ul li a { color:#fff;text-decoration:none;margin-right:30px;}
#footer ul li a:hover { text-decoration:underline;}

#footer .copyright { float:right;font-size:10px;margin-right:25px;}

.quote { margin:0px 40px -20px 70px;}
.quote span.ldquo { display:block;float:left;height:200px;font-size:180px;margin-left:-70px;margin-top:-40px;margin-bottom:-140px;	}
.quote span.rdquo { display:block;float:right;font-size:180px;height:20px;/*margin-left:280px;*/	margin-top:-55px;margin-bottom:-180px;	}

.quoted  { font-size:12px;float:left;	margin:0px 0px 0px 70px;	}

#copy    { height:475px; min-height:475px;height:auto; }
#copy p  { padding-bottom:20px; }
#copy ul { list-style:none; margin:0px 0px 20px 10px;}

#template1 #copy  { margin-left:25px;width:480px; }
#template1 .image { float:right;width:356px;margin-right:20px; }

#template2 #copy  { margin-left:335px;width:480px; }
#template2 .image { float:left;width:335px; }

#template3 #copy  { margin-left:25px;width:350px;}
#template3 .image { float:right;width:506px;margin-right:20px;}
#news .image { float:right;margin-right:20px;}

#side-nav {width:200px;}
#side-nav ul{list-style:none;margin:28px 0px 0px 25px;line-height:2.2em;}

#layout-table {width:100%}
#layout-table #copy{padding:0px 20px;}

#products #layout-table #col1 {
width:50%;
height:416px;
background-image: url(/wp-content/themes/digitalagua/images/products/bg_business.jpg);
background-repeat: no-repeat;
background-position: right top;}
#products #layout-table #col1 div {margin:100px 15px 0px 245px;}
#products #layout-table #col2 div {margin:25px 40px 0px 40px; text-align:right;}
#products #layout-table #col1 h3 {color:#69006e;}
#products #layout-table #col2 h3 {color:#FF9900;}
#products #layout-table em {font-weight:bold;}
#products #layout-table #col1 .btn { margin-left:70px;margin-top:30px;}
#products #layout-table #col2 .btn { margin-left:70px;margin-top:30px;}

#products #layout-table #col2 {
	width:50%;
	border-left:1px solid #e7e7e7;
	height:416px;
	background-image: url(/wp-content/themes/digitalagua/images/products/bg_people.jpg);
	background-repeat: no-repeat;
	background-position: left top;
}

#copy .nav3 {list-style:none;margin:30px 0px 00px 0px;padding-bottom:20px;}
#copy .nav3 li {float:left;margin:0px;padding:0px;margin-right:20px;}
#copy .nav3 li.talk {
	display:block;
	float:right;
	vertical-align:middle;
	padding-right:20px;
	background-image: url(/wp-content/themes/digitalagua/images/talk.png);
	background-repeat: no-repeat;
	background-position: right center;
}
#copy .nav3 li.talk a{	color:#0081d3;}

.feature-table td {padding-bottom:20px;}
.feature-table .col1{width:180px;}

.screens-table .col1 {width:210px;}
.screens-table .col1 ul {list-style:none;}
.screens-table .col1 li {float:left;width:93px;}
.screens-table .col2 {text-align:center;}

.news-table .col1 {width:100px;color:#333;font-size:10px;vertical-align:top;}
.news-table .col2 {font-size:14px;vertical-align:top;}
.questions,.questions li {padding:0; margin:0;}
.mtop10 {margin-top:10px;}
.mtop20 {margin-top:20px;}
.mtop30 {margin-top:30px;}
.ptop20 {padding-top:10px;}
.ptop20 {padding-top:20px;}
.ptop20 {padding-top:30px;}
.mtop-15 {margin-top:-15px;}

code {
	display:block;
	font-size:11px;
	margin:10px 0px 20px 0px;
	padding:10px;
	background-color:#eee;
	border:1px solid #ccc;
	}
	
	.cats li {font-size:15px;}
